Моделирование работы участка цеха 


Мы поможем в написании ваших работ!



ЗНАЕТЕ ЛИ ВЫ?

Моделирование работы участка цеха



 

Необходимо промоделировать работу участка цеха, состоящего из нескольких станков и обрабатывающего два потока деталей различного типа. Маршрут обработки деталей двух типов представлен на рис. 1. В таб.1 представлено распределение выполняемых операций по станкам А1, А2 и А3. Интервалы времени между поступлениями деталей и времена выполнения операций распределены равномерно. Информация о временах поступления и выполнения операций заданы в таб.2 и таб.3.

Определить для рабочего дня (8 часов) и рабочей недели (5 дней при односменном режиме) среднюю загрузку каждого станка, среднее время обработки деталей каждого типа, какова длина очередей на обработку для станков, какой размер склада необходим для данного потока деталей. Предложить способы модификации участка цеха с целью повышения эффективности его работы.

 

 

Таблица 1. Распределение операций по станкам

 

Вариант   Операция 1 Операция 2 Операция 3 Операция 4 Операция 5 Операция 6
Пример A1 A2 A3 A1 A3 A2
1 A1 A2 A3 A3 A2 A1
2 A1 A2 A3 A3 A1 A2
3 A1 A2 A3 A1 A2 A3
4 A1 A2 A3 A2 A1 A3
5 A1 A2 A3 A2 A3 A1
6 A2 A1 A3 A1 A2 A3
7 A2 A1 A3 A1 A3 A2
8 A2 A1 A3 A2 A1 A3
9 A2 A1 A3 A2 A3 A1
10 A2 A1 A3 A3 A1 A2
11 A2 A1 A3 A3 A2 A3
12 A3 A1 A3 A1 A2 A3

 

 

Таблица 2. 

 

Вариант Интервалы времени поступления деталей первого типа (мин.) Интервалы времени поступления деталей второго типа (мин.)
Пример 30 + 5 20 + 5
1 25 + 4 25 + 6
2 20 + 3 30 + 7
3 15 + 5 35 + 8
4 10 + 4 20 + 5
5 30 + 5 10 + 3
6 15 + 4 15 + 6
7 30 + 10 15 + 3
8 20 + 5 20 + 5
9 25 + 4 10 + 3
10 45 + 5 15 + 5
11 20 + 4 15 + 3
12 10 + 3 15 + 5

 

Таблица 3.

 

Вариант Интервал времени выполнения операции 1 (мин.) Интервал времени выполнения операции 2 (мин.) Интервал времени выполнения операции 3 (мин.) Интервал времени выполнения операции 4 (мин.) Интервал времени выполнения операции 5 (мин.) Интервал времени выполнения операции 6 (мин.)
Пример 5 + 2 20 + 4 10 + 3 7 + 3 15 + 5 15 + 5
1 20 + 4 5 + 2 15 + 5 15 + 5 7 + 3 10 + 3
2 10 + 3 15 + 5 5 + 2 20 + 4 10 + 3 7 + 3
3 18 + 3 10 + 3 12 + 5 20 + 4 25 + 8 12 + 4
4 12 + 5 15 + 5 18 + 3 10 + 3 5 + 2 20 + 4
5 15 + 5 20 + 4 10 + 3 18 + 3 12 + 5 20 + 4
6 10 + 3 25 + 8 5 + 2 15 + 5 18 + 3 15 + 5
7 15 + 5 12 + 5 20 + 4 5 + 2 10 + 3 18 + 3
8 20 + 4 18 + 3 10 + 3 7 + 3 15 + 5 25 + 8
9 10 + 3 15 + 5 10 + 3 12 + 5 5 + 2 20 + 4
10 25 + 8 5 + 2 12 + 5 7 + 3 10 + 3 15 + 5
11 20 + 4 10 + 3 15 + 5 5 + 2 12 + 5 25 + 8
12 12 + 5 20 + 4 25 + 8 15 + 5 5 + 2 10 + 3

 

Пример

 

Исходные данные для структуры участка цеха и интервалы времени поступления деталей на станок, выполняющий первую операцию (для деталей первого типа) и на станок, выполняющий четвертую операцию (для деталей второго типа), а также интервалы времени обработки каждым станком заданы в таблицах 1, 2 и 3.

 

 

Таблица 4. Таблица определений для примера

 

Элементы GPSS Назначение
Транзакты: 1-й сегмент модели 2-й сегмент модели 3-й сегмент модели   Детали первого типа Детали второго типа Таймер
Станки: А1 А2 А3 Выполнение операции 1 и операции 4 операции 2 и операции 6 операции 3 и операции 5
Очереди: АА1 АА2 АА3   Общая очередь к станку А1 Общая очередь к станку А2 Общая очередь к станку А3

 

Единица времени в модели - 1 мин.

 

Иммитационная модель системы

 

; GPSS/PC Program File EX1. (V 2, # 39560) 03-01-1999 12:36:18

SIMULATE       

GENERATE 30,5 Первый сегмент модели

QUEUE   AA1  

SEIZE   A1   

DEPART  AA1  

ADVANCE 5,2  

RELEASE A1  

QUEUE   AA2  

SEIZE   A2  

DEPART  AA2  

ADVANCE 20,4    

RELEASE A2  

QUEUE   AA3  

SEIZE   A3  

DEPART  AA3  

ADVANCE 10,3  

RELEASE A3  

TERMINATE       

GENERATE 20,5   Второй сегмент модели

QUEUE   AA1  

SEIZE   A1  

DEPART  AA1  

ADVANCE 7,3  

 

RELEASE A1  

QUEUE   AA3  

SEIZE   A3  

DEPART  AA3  

ADVANCE 15,5  

RELEASE A3  

QUEUE   AA2  

SEIZE   A2  

DEPART  AA2  

ADVANCE 15,5  

RELEASE A2  

TERMINATE      

GENERATE 480   Третий сегмент модели (таймер)

TERMINATE 1

 

В данном примере таймер настроен на выполнение моделирования в течение 8 часового рабочего дня. Для выполнения моделирования в течение 5 дней таймер должен быть откорректирован.

 

 

 

Анализ результатов иммитационного моделирования

 

Распечатка выходных данных для моделирования работы участка цеха в течение рабочего дня.

 

 

GPSS/PC Report file REPORT.GPS. (V 2, # 39560) 03-02-1999 13:45:52 page 1

 

START_TIME END_TIME BLOCKS FACILITIES STORAGES FREE_MEMORY

0     480 36      3     0    13264

 

 

 LINE  LOC     BLOCK_TYPE  ENTRY_COUNT CURRENT_COUNT RETRY

110   1       GENERATE          15         0       0

120   2       QUEUE             15         0    0

130   3       SEIZE             15         0    0

140   4       DEPART            15         0    0

150   5          ADVANCE           15         0    0

160   6       RELEASE           15         0    0

170   7       QUEUE             15         4    0

180   8       SEIZE             11         0    0

190   9       DEPART            11         0    0

200   10      ADVANCE           11         1    0

210   11      RELEASE           10         0         0

220   12      QUEUE             10         0    0

230   13      SEIZE             10         0    0

240   14      DEPART            10         0    0

250   15      ADVANCE           10         0    0

260   16      RELEASE           10         0    0

270   17      TERMINATE         10         0    0

280   18      GENERATE          24         0    0

290   19      QUEUE             24         0    0

300   20      SEIZE             24         0    0

DEPART            24         0    0

320   22      ADVANCE           24         0    0

330   23      RELEASE           24         0    0

340   24      QUEUE             24         0    0

350   25      SEIZE             24         0    0

360   26      DEPART            24         0    0

370   27      ADVANCE           24         1    0

380   28      RELEASE            23         0    0

390   29      QUEUE             23         7    0

400   30      SEIZE             16         0    0

410   31      DEPART            16         0    0

420   32      ADVANCE           16         0    0

430   33      RELEASE           16         0    0

440   34      TERMINATE         16         0    0

450   35      GENERATE           1         0    0

460   36      TERMINATE          1         0    0

 

 

 

FACILITY ENTRIES UTIL. AVE._TIME AVAILABLE OWNER PEND INTER RETRY DELAY

 A1        39 0.479     5.90 1    0 0 0 0 0

 A2        27 0.918  16.33 1   29 0 0 0 11

 A3        34 0.877  12.38 1   40 0 0 0 0

 

 

QUEUE    MAX CONT. ENTRIES ENTRIES(0) AVE.CONT. AVE.TIME AVE.(-0) RETRY

 AA1       1 0 39   32 0.03   0.41 2.29 0

 AA2      12 11 38    1 5.08  64.16 65.89 0

 AA3       2 0 34   10 0.28   3.97 5.63 0

 

 

Распечатка выходных данных для моделирования работы участка цеха в течение рабочей недели.

 

 



Поделиться:


Последнее изменение этой страницы: 2020-12-09; просмотров: 487; Нарушение авторского права страницы; Мы поможем в написании вашей работы!

infopedia.su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Обратная связь - 3.15.229.113 (0.023 с.)